After only 25 episodes, the show was ended. But Scooby wasn’t ready for the end yet, so Hanna Barbera Productions made a new show out of the gang, The New Scooby-Doo Movies. This show featured the gang solving mysteries with different guest stars including Don Knotts, the Harlem Globetrotters, Batman and Robin and more. After a few seasons, the show moved to ABC and was altered almost every season. It was changed to Scooby-Doo and Scrappy-Doo, and it featured Scooby, Shaggy, and Scooby’s
pup nephew, Scrappy.

Over the next three decades, the show changed numerous times; after Scooby-Doo and Scrappy-Doo, it was The New Scooby-Doo Mysteries, then The 13 Ghosts of Scooby-Doo, then A Pup Named Scooby-Doo, What’s New Scooby-Doo, and Shaggy & Scooby-Doo Get a Clue! Over the years, there have been numerous movie specials, and even two big-screen movies made. As long as people are still interested in Scooby-Doo, they will continue making new shows and movies about him.
